XLV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2019 in Review

840 of the 4,560 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in State Street Health Care Select Sector SPDR ETF (XLV) for Q3 2019, worth a combined $12.7B — down 2.6% from $13.1B a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 104 funds closed out of XLV and 65 opened new positions — a net loss of 39 holders — while 337 trimmed existing stakes and 288 added.

The largest buyer was Bank of America, adding an estimated $498M. The largest seller was Wells Fargo, cutting an estimated $321M.
